Transaction 03dfd7115afdf93504bb96a3fe7c423bfac17720883a67bf59e656952a2936bf
2 Input
2 Outputs
- 03dfd7115afdf93504bb96a3fe7c423bfac17720883a67bf59e656952a2936bf:0
- 03dfd7115afdf93504bb96a3fe7c423bfac17720883a67bf59e656952a2936bf:1
value 5011654
address 15KzdWvzw6JQALBwxWsKVrrSvWLyV5MFHo
value 27531373
address 1CJvrsqo6LA4jtwPp7gUXvAwNR1ZW2X9T1